(1 of 2) ...The National Weather Service in Little Rock AR has issued a Flood Warning for the following river in Arkansas... Black River At Black Rock affecting Independence, Jackson and Lawrence Counties. For the Black River...including Corning, Pocahontas, Black Rock... Minor flooding is forecast. * W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Black River at Black Rock. * WHEN...From Friday morning until further notice. * IMPACTS...At 14.0 feet, Minor flooding begins. Farm ground along east bank begins to flood.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 10:00 AM CDT Thursday the stage was 13.8 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age Friday morning and continue rising to a crest of 14.5 feet early Sunday morning. - Flood stage is 14.0 feet.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ood (2 of 2) ...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Arkansas... Ouachita River At Felsenthal Lock and Dam affecting Ashley and Union Counties. For the Ouachita River...including Felsenthal Lock and Dam...Minor flooding is forecast. * W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Ouachita River at Felsenthal Lock and Dam. * WHEN...Until Saturday morning.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 8:30 AM CDT Thursday the stage was 70.3 feet. - Bankfull stage is 65.0 feet. - Recent Activity...The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 8:30 AM CDT Thursday was 70.6 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to continue to slowly fall this afternoon. It will then fall below flood stage just after midnight tonight. - Flood stage is 70.0 feet. - Flood History...This crest compares to a previous crest of 70.2 feet on 12/14/2015.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
